本篇目录:
- 1、用PHP语言在不改变图片尺寸的前提下如何降低前台页面全部图片的分辨率...
- 2、php文章中图片处理的使用
- 3、...如何压缩已上传的服务器中的图片,有没有好用的php页面源码
- 4、php图片上传后被压缩了,变得不清晰了,怎么解决
- 5、php将pdf文件格式转换成图片,并压缩
- 6、在php图片合成时,两张图片加上一个文字水印,合成后背景底部图片会变色...
用PHP语言在不改变图片尺寸的前提下如何降低前台页面全部图片的分辨率...
WINDOWS的话你可以另外开发一个软件放在服务器上,实时监测是否有新的图片上传上来,有的话你就执行图片的大小尺寸或者图片画质的压缩,当然你的软件也可以通过访问你的PHP程序来完成图片压缩。
海报是用img标签显示的吗?如果是的话,就给这张图片加width:100%,所有包裹该图片的标签都设置width:100%。就可以了。
裁剪的结果就是显示不全)。解决的方法:给图片(img)的宽度加上百分比进行控制(100%)。可能出现的情况:图片大小不一。【解决:控制所有图片的实际大小必须一致,这样经过缩放之后才会大小一致】。
php文章中图片处理的使用
在PHP网站开发过程中,如果建立的网站涉及大量的图片处理,必然涉及到图片的上传和缩放,保持图片不失真,进行图片缩放。使用之前需要下载安装GD库,以支持PHP图片处理。下面结合代码讲解具体的PHP图片缩放处理的思路。
可以用imagettftext来生成,支持truetype字体 array imagettftext ( resource image, float size, float angle, int x, int y, int color, string fontfile, string text )image 图像资源。见 imagecreatetruecolor()。
首先需要创建数据表,具体代码如下图所示。然后写上传图片到服务器的页面 upimage.html用来将图片上传数据库,如下图所示代码。处理图片上传的php upimage.php文件,如下图所示图片已储存到数据库。
你要先确定数据库字段的类型,假设,这个字段是文本型,那么就不能输入其他类型的数据(也就是说,你不能把图片的内容保存到文本类型的字段里)。
设置数据库 我们通常在数据库中所使用的文本或整数类型的字段和需要用来保存图片的字段的不同之处就在于两者所需要保存的数据量不同。MySQL数据库使用专门的字段来保存大容量的数据,数据类型为BLOB。
...如何压缩已上传的服务器中的图片,有没有好用的php页面源码
1、WINDOWS的话你可以另外开发一个软件放在服务器上,实时监测是否有新的图片上传上来,有的话你就执行图片的大小尺寸或者图片画质的压缩,当然你的软件也可以通过访问你的PHP程序来完成图片压缩。
2、你说的压缩,实际上就是生成缩略图。你利用生成缩略图后,缩略图可以直接保存到服务器上成为文件,不需要再保存到postedFile中了。
3、模式压缩图片:可根据需求选择图片压缩模式(如缩小优先、清晰优先),并支持自定义设图片压缩的清晰度、分辨率、格式以及希望大小。
4、此方法是针对已经是JPEG格式的图片,还可以进一步减小其所占的空间,那就是用压缩软件,我们的电脑一般都有的,如果没有可以先安装,看好,图片的大小是90MB。之后右键打开文件选择列表,选择“添加到压缩文件夹”。
5、常用的压缩工具有 UglifyJS、CSSNano、Terser 等 。 使用 CDN:CDN 可以将静态资源分发到全球各地的服务器上,从而使用户能够更快地获取到资源。使用 CDN 可以减少服务器负载和网络延迟 。
php图片上传后被压缩了,变得不清晰了,怎么解决
首先,在电脑端安装嗨格式图片无损放大器的软件,安装完之后,双击软件图标并运行嗨格式图片无损放大器,根据自己的需要在软件展现界面,选择自己需要的功能。
第二,将高清大图裁剪一下再传。将高清大图裁剪一下就可以在可控范围内降低像素,又不至于被过度压缩而导致模糊。第三,避免上传低像素照片。有的图片本来像素就不高,上传之后被人下载次数多了就更模糊。
thinkphp如何做图片压缩呢?在上传图片的时候先看看图片有多大,一般来说导航幻灯片的图片单张大小尽量不超100k,产品图不超过20k,这样加载还慢的话就用ajax后加载方法,可以是滚动加载之类,但是对蜘蛛抓取页面并不是很友好。
因为现在许多免费服务器都设置了自动压缩图片功能,用户将原片上传至服务器后,照片质量自然就打折扣了。
这将使照片上传后保持更高的质量,尽可能减少模糊和失真的可能性。另外,还可以使用一些软件或在线工具对照片进行压缩和优化,以减小文件大小而又不影响质量,这也是解决此类问题的方法之一。
php将pdf文件格式转换成图片,并压缩
1、这是一个非常简单的格式转换代码,可以把.PDF文件转换为.JPG文件,代码要起作用,服务器必须要安装ImageMagick扩展。
2、下载一个PDF阅读器,比如Adobe Reader , Foxit Reader(福昕阅读器)等等。用Adobe Reader打开PDF文档。使用Adobe Reader上的快照功能,选上需要的图片。4 打开系统自带的画图工具,点击黏贴 。
3、(1)在AdobeAcrobat中打开想要压缩的PDF文件,然后点击左上角的菜单栏后,点击“另外为”,将PDF文件存储为Word格式。
在php图片合成时,两张图片加上一个文字水印,合成后背景底部图片会变色...
1、所有图片加水印后,软件会自动打开输出目录文件夹。第四步,从案例中可以看出,所有图片都添加了统一的水印。
2、这个时候就可以用到一个软件叫hypersnap,它可以自动存储你的水印,然后在你之后的图片中自动打上水印。
3、PHP图像处理模块 MagickWand用法 MagickWand 是一个PHP的模块,用来访问 ImageMagick 的图像处理库。
4、首先在手机上找到并打开美图秀秀APP。接下来在页面中选择红色箭头所指处的“美化图片”。接下来在相册中选择需要添加水印的图片。接下来在页面中选择红色箭头所指处的“文字”。
5、加两文字水印,弄成加两次水印就行,不过效率就差点。可以考虑加图片的水印 你用什么编辑器?如果是记事本的话很容易出现乱码问题,网页是UTF-8了,但是你记事本存储的却是GBK。推荐用Editlus 3,网上有注册版的。
6、水印弄在图片上的方法:打开美图app,首先在手机上找到并打开美图秀秀APP;美化图片,在页面中所指处的“美化图片”;点开文字在页面中选择所指处的“文字”;添加水印,在页面中选择处的“水印”,在图片上添加水印即可。
到此,以上就是小编对于php处理图片需要什么扩展的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。